Currahee! by Donald R. Burgett is a firsthand combat memoir chronicling the experiences of a young U.S. Army paratrooper in the 101st Airborne Division (“Screaming Eagles”) during the D-Day invasion of Normandy in June 1944. The title comes from the regiment’s battle cry and motto.

Panzer Leader (original German title: Erinnerungen eines Soldaten, meaning "Memories of a Soldier") is the autobiography of German General Heinz Guderian, written during his imprisonment by the Allies after World War II and first published in English in 1952. The book provides a detailed account of Guderian’s military career, focusing on his pioneering work in armored warfare and the creation of Germany’s panzer divisions in the 1930s.

Brazen Chariots is a vivid, day-by-day memoir by Major Robert Crisp, a South African-born British tank commander in the Third Royal Tank Regiment. First published in 1959, it is widely regarded as one of the most acclaimed narratives of tank warfare in World War II.

Stalingrad chronicles the siege and destruction of the German Sixth Army, written by ex-war correspondent Heinz Schroter and based on official German records, memoirs and interviews.

The Battle of the Bulge (originally published in 1947 as Dark December) is a detailed, first-hand account of the German Army’s last major offensive of World War II, which took place from 16 December 1944 to 25 January 1945. Written by Robert E. Merriam, a U.S. Army captain and later chief of the Ardennes section of the Army Historical Division, the book offers a blow-by-blow chronicle of the Ardennes offensive, drawing on his direct experience during the battle and extensive postwar interviews with both Allied and German officers, as well as examination of battle records.
